Europe Day In Chisinau

 May 9th is Victory Day in the former Soviet Union.  May 10th is Europe Day.  On the ninth, we saw groups of Socialists and Communists honoring the dead of WWII and waving red flags all over downtown.  This is what we saw on the tenth.  The smoke you see is from cooking sausages, not anything alarming.  

It was a rainy afternoon, so the turnout was lower than usual.  Everyone there seemed to have a good time, including the flag-bedecked patrol cars.
